Ingredients

- 1 ½ cups warm water (110°F – 115°F)
- 1 packet (2 ¼ tsp) active dry yeast
- 1 tablespoon granulated sugar
- 4 cups all-purpose flour
- 1 teaspoon salt
- ½ cup baking soda (for boiling water)
- 1 large egg (for egg wash)
- Coarse sea salt (for sprinkling)
Instructions
- In a large bowl, combine the warm water, yeast, and sugar. Let it sit for about 5 minutes until frothy.
- Add the flour and salt to the yeast mixture and mix until a dough forms.
- Knead the dough on a floured surface for about 5 minutes until smooth and elastic.
- Place the dough in a greased bowl, cover with a towel, and let it rise for about 1 hour, or until doubled in size.
- Preheat your oven to 425°F (220°C) and line a baking sheet with parchment paper.
- Bring a large pot of water to a boil and add the baking soda.
- Turn the dough onto a floured surface and divide it into 8 equal pieces. Roll each piece into a rope and cut into bite-sized pieces.
- Boil the pretzel bites in the baking soda water for about 30 seconds, then remove them with a slotted spoon and place on the lined baking sheet.
- In a small bowl, beat the egg and brush it over the pretzel bites. Sprinkle with coarse sea salt.
- Bake in the preheated oven for 12-15 minutes until golden brown.
- Allow to cool slightly before serving with your favorite dips.
Notes
- For extra flavor, you can add garlic powder or cheese powder to the dough.
- Serve with mustard, cheese sauce, or caramel for dipping.
- These pretzel bites can be frozen after baking; reheat in the oven for best results.
